Assessing Wall Problem
Prior to you get your paintbrush, take a moment to examine your walls' condition. Check for any kind of noticeable damages like splits, holes, or peeling paint. These blemishes can influence just how the paint adheres and looks when it's completely dry. If you discover any substantial damages, you'll require to focus on fixings prior to diving right into painting.

Cleansing the Surface area
As soon as you have actually examined the condition of your wall surfaces, the following step is cleaning up the surface. Begin by gathering tulsa patios : a pail, warm water, a light cleaning agent, a sponge or cloth, and a scrub brush for tougher areas.
Begin on top corner of the wall surface and work your method down. Mix the cleaning agent with warm water in your pail, after that dip the sponge or fabric right into the remedy. Wring it bent on prevent extreme dampness on the wall surfaces.
As you clean, pay attention to areas that may've accumulated dirt, grease, or fingerprints. For stubborn spots, use the scrub brush gently to stay clear of harming the paint beneath. Rinse your sponge or fabric often in clean water to stop spreading out dirt around.
After cleaning, it's important to clean the walls with a wet cloth to get rid of any soap deposit. This step ensures a smooth surface for the new paint to comply with.
Enable the walls to dry completely prior to moving on to the next preparation actions. This extensive cleansing process will help create a fresh canvas for your paint project, making sure the most effective results.
Patching and Priming
Patching and priming are essential steps in preparing your walls for a fresh layer of paint. First, check your walls for any type of holes, fractures, or flaws. Utilize a high-grade spackling substance or patching paste to load these locations.
Use the compound with a putty blade, smoothing it out so it's flush with the surrounding surface area. Allow it to completely dry completely, and then sand it lightly till it's smooth and even.
As soon as you have actually covered whatever, it's time to prime. Guide aids secure the patched locations, ensuring the paint adheres effectively and offers a consistent finish. Select a guide appropriate for your wall type and the paint you'll be utilizing.
Use the primer utilizing a roller for larger areas and a brush for edges and sides. If your patched areas are substantially big or porous, you might wish to apply a 2nd coat of guide after the first one dries out.
After priming, let everything completely dry thoroughly before going on to paint. This prep work will not only boost the appearance of your wall surfaces but also lengthen the life of your paint work.
